Re tender - Contract 23 - Planned and Responsive 2025 -2027

Published

Description

The Authority invites suitably experienced providers for the above Framework to provide a skilled service and provide Traditional and Non Traditional for both Planned and Responsive Works,Contract 23 - Planned and Responsive 2025 -2027 (the Works) . This Framework Contract will ensure availability of skilled Contractors to deliver the different Lots in the Framework requiring differing values and complexities as required for the Framework Contract. It would be desirable for Tenderers to have an NFRC membership and a NASC accredited supplier will be required to carry out any Scaffolding Works in Lot 3 (sub-contractors if required) as stated in the Scope of Works and Additional Quality Questions (a3. AQQ) document. For the purposes of the CDM regulations 2015, generally North Tyneside Council (the Authority) will act as Principal Contractor, however on occasion the Contractor may be requested to act as Principal Contractor from time to time and the specific details and Contract Terms would be issued at Mini Competition stage should this be required. Successfully awarded Contractors will be required to work together with North Tyneside Council (the Authority) to drive improvements and support the aims and ambitions of the Contract. The main areas of activity may comprise of, but not exclusively be limited to, New Installations, Repairs and Modifications to existing roofs, including associated timberwork, flashings, membranes, metalwork, rainwater goods, roof windows, fascias and soffits, green roofs and also other planned investment works requiring services to be completed in ether of the following forms; Operational, schools, commercial and any other properties owned by the Authority or its subsidiaries which may also include properties for sale. The specific Projects details that may be procured under this Framework Contract cannot be clearly defined at this stage but further details are included in the Scope of Works along with the other tender documents Following this tender exercise, it is envisaged that 5 Contractors will be appointed to the Framework. Works 3 lots. For Lots 1 and 2 (Planned), Rank 1 gets all work up to £50,000 as a Direct Award for 24 months and then there is an annual price refresh should any extension option be taken. For Lot 3 (Responsive(including Traditional and Non-Traditional)), all work goes to Rank 1 for 24 month, or using the Ranking order if the supplier is unable to carry out the works, as a Direct Award and then annual price refresh should any extension option be taken.
